Ingredient List:
3 large yellow, sweet onions
3 large red onions
2 garlic cloves
4 tablespoons salted butter
4 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ons all purpose flour
¼ cup red wine (I used Cabernet Sauvignon)
2 containers (32 ounce each) beef stock
¼ teaspoon dried thyme
2 bay leaves
½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on black pepper
½ loaf of french bread
4 to 6 ounces gruyere cheese
